Essential Bolt.new Hacks: Build Better Apps with AI Using These Tips
Last updated
January 7, 2025
Header 1
Header 2
Header 3
Header 4
Header 5
Header 6
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um.
When it comes to developing apps with Bolt AI, there are several key strategies that can significantly enhance your results. By implementing these Bolt AI app development tips, you'll be well on your way to building better apps and maximizing the potential of this powerful tool.
Enhancing Design in Bolt AI Apps
One of the most effective ways to improve your Bolt AI apps is by focusing on design optimization. Here's how you can achieve this:
Leverage the "Similar to" Prompt for Design Inspiration
After Bolt AI builds your initial prototype, use a simple prompt to enhance the design while maintaining functionality. Try saying something like, "Now please update the design and keep all the functionality. I want you to design it similar to [insert app name]." This approach allows you to quickly add a polished look to your app.
Draw Inspiration from Popular App Designs
When using the "similar to" prompt, consider referencing well-known apps with appealing designs. For example, you could ask Bolt AI to design your app similar to Spotify's aesthetic. This can result in a sleek, modern look that's instantly recognizable and user-friendly.
Balance Aesthetics and Functionality
While improving the visual appeal of your app is important, it's crucial to maintain its core functionality. Always emphasize in your prompts that you want to keep all the existing features intact while updating the design. This ensures that your app not only looks great but also performs as intended.
Mastering API Integration for Building Better Apps with Bolt AI
API integration is a critical aspect of app development, and Bolt AI can help streamline this process. Here are some tips for effective API integration:
Update Outdated API Models
Bolt AI may sometimes use outdated API models. To address this, research the latest API documentation for the services you're integrating. For example, if you're working with OpenAI's Vision model, make sure you're using the most current version, such as GPT-4 instead of older models.
Reference Current API Documentation
When encountering issues with API integration, go directly to the source. Visit the official documentation of the API you're working with, such as OpenAI's documentation for vision-related tasks. Copy and paste relevant sections of the documentation into your conversation with Bolt AI to ensure it has the most up-to-date information.
Convince Bolt AI to Adopt New API Implementations
If Bolt AI resists using updated API models, don't be afraid to assertively present your research. Explain that you've done the necessary research and ask it to try the new implementation, even if just as an experiment. Treat the AI as a collaborative partner and be prepared to guide it towards the correct solution.
Troubleshoot API Key Issues
When facing API-related errors, such as authentication problems, use Bolt AI's chat feature to locate the correct files for inserting API keys. Ask specific questions like, "Where do I put the correct API key?" Bolt AI will guide you to the right location, often an environment file, where you can securely add your API credentials.
Troubleshooting Bolt AI Issues and Improving Functionality
Encountering issues is part of the development process. Here's how to effectively troubleshoot and enhance your Bolt AI apps:
Use Bolt's Automatic Problem-Solving Features
Take advantage of Bolt AI's built-in problem-solving capabilities. When you encounter an issue, look for buttons or options that say "Try to fix problem" or similar. Clicking these can often resolve common issues automatically, saving you time and effort.
Engage with the Bolt AI Chatbot for Coding Assistance
Don't hesitate to ask the Bolt AI chatbot for help with coding problems. It can provide guidance on navigating code files, making necessary adjustments, and resolving errors. This feature is particularly useful for developers who may not be familiar with every aspect of the codebase.
Navigate Code Files and Make Adjustments
Sometimes, you'll need to manually edit code files. Use the Bolt AI chatbot to locate the correct files and understand the changes required. For instance, if you need to update an API key, the chatbot can direct you to the appropriate environment file and explain how to make the changes securely.
Persist in Resolving Errors and Conflicts
When automatic fixes don't work, be prepared to investigate further. Ask the Bolt AI chatbot more detailed questions, review error messages carefully, and don't be afraid to try multiple approaches to solve a problem. Persistence is often key in troubleshooting complex issues.
Optimizing Prompt Construction for Bolt AI App Development
The way you construct prompts can significantly impact the quality of your Bolt AI-generated apps. Here are some tips for creating effective prompts:
Provide Specific Examples in Prompts
When asking Bolt AI to create or modify an app, include specific examples to guide its output. For instance, if you're building an upvote site, mention "product hunt" as an example. This gives Bolt AI a clearer direction and often results in more accurate and relevant app designs.
Improve Initial App Prototypes Through Detailed Instructions
Don't settle for the first prototype Bolt AI generates. Provide detailed instructions for improvements, focusing on both functionality and design. Be specific about the features you want to add or modify, and reference existing apps or interfaces that align with your vision.
Balance Creativity and Clarity in Prompt Writing
While it's important to be specific, allow some room for Bolt AI's creativity. Strike a balance between clear instructions and open-ended prompts that enable the AI to suggest innovative solutions. This approach can lead to unique and effective app designs that you might not have considered initially.
By applying these Bolt AI app development tips, you'll be well-equipped to create more sophisticated, user-friendly, and efficient applications. Remember, the key to success with Bolt AI lies in clear communication, persistent problem-solving, and a willingness to experiment with different approaches.
Ready to take your no-code skills to the next level? Sign up for No Code MBA and gain access to comprehensive courses that will help you master tools like Bolt AI and more. Join our community of innovators today!
FAQ (Frequently Asked Questions)
What is Bolt AI and how does it help in app development?
Bolt AI is an artificial intelligence tool that assists in app development by generating code, designs, and functionality based on user prompts. It helps streamline the development process, allowing even those with limited coding experience to create sophisticated applications.
How can I improve the design of my Bolt AI-generated app?
You can improve your app's design by using the "similar to" prompt, referencing popular apps for inspiration, and balancing aesthetics with functionality. Always specify that you want to maintain existing features while updating the design.
What should I do if Bolt AI is using outdated API models?
Research the latest API documentation for the services you're integrating, and provide this updated information to Bolt AI. Be persistent in convincing the AI to adopt new implementations, even if it initially resists the change.
How can I effectively troubleshoot issues in my Bolt AI app?
Utilize Bolt's automatic problem-solving features, engage with the Bolt AI chatbot for coding assistance, navigate code files to make manual adjustments when necessary, and persist in resolving errors through multiple approaches if needed.
What are some tips for writing effective prompts for Bolt AI?
Provide specific examples in your prompts, give detailed instructions for improving initial prototypes, and strike a balance between creativity and clarity. This approach helps Bolt AI understand your vision and generate more accurate and relevant app designs.